lzth.net
当前位置:首页 >> python文本长度处理 >>

python文本长度处理

# -*- coding: utf-8 -*-""":created on: 2015年4月17日:author: Chuanqing Qin:contact: qinchuanqing918@sina.com"""def str_len(temp): return len(unicode(temp, 'utf-8'))def deal_file(file_in): with open(file_in, 'r') as f: for line ...

def f(): lines=open("1.txt","r").readlines() lens=[] for line in lines: lens.append(len(line.strip('\n')))lens存的每行长度

len(s) < 4 len函数用于获取字符串长度,因此上述表达式用于判断字符串s的长度是否小于4

%4d 右对齐 %-4d 左对齐

两个。 反斜杠 是 “转意符" -- 改变后面字符的含义, 比如: \r : 回车, \n : 换行, \t : 制表符 .。 为了表达字符"反斜杠(\)" 需要在其前面在加一个反斜杠 : \\。 就是说,你看到的字符串中的 \\ 就是一个 "\"。

def func(a): if len(a)>8: a=a[:8]+'***' print a k="里约奥运会" >>> func(k) 里约奥运***

给你一个例子代码。 with open('filename.txt','rb') as fp: line = fp.readline() while line: extracted = line[:-1] #就是这里,去掉最后一个,倒数第1 extracted = line[:101] #取前面101个字符 extracted = line[1:10] #取前面第2到第10个...

python的数据是可以动态增长的,直接定义使用a=[]即可; 比如: a=[0,1,2],这时a[0]=0, a[1]=1, a[[2]=2; 如果数组想a想定义为0到999,这时可能通过a = range(0, 1000)实现;或省略为a = range(1000); 如果想定义1000长度的a,初始值全为0,则 ...

什么叫确定字符串的长度, len(str)或str.__len__()可获取字符串长度

#coding=utf-8test_str = u'提问123'print len(test_str) # 输出5或者 #coding=utf-8test_str = '提问123'test_str_unicode = test_str.decode('utf-8')print len(test_str_unicode) # 输出5求这种长度可以转化成求解码(unicode)的长度;报Un...

网站首页 | 网站地图
All rights reserved Powered by www.lzth.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com